Organisers of the 12th annual Clutha Super Masters Games yesterday were thrilled with the turnout of nearly 100 people from throughout the district.
Teams made up from rest-homes and clubs converged on the Balclutha War Memorial Hall for the gathering, which began with the traditional opening ceremony. Sporting personalities Corale Willocks and Bruce Park carried the flame and Ensign flag respectively, while teams lined up behind them to march around the hall.
After the formalities, the real fun began, with skittles, quoits, twister throw, floor netball and darts.
